New Havian integration: Auto-update production sequences

SurvOPT now integrates with Havian, allowing production sequence data to be automatically imported into your project. Using the Havian API, SurvOPT can retrieve completed production sequences directly from Havian and create matching completed sequences within the SurvOPT project. This removes the need for manual data entry or export/import workflows, and ensures that production updates are reflected accurately and quickly.

When Havian Auto Update is running, SurvOPT will periodically check Havian for completed sequences. Imported sequences are automatically matched based on preplot name and shot point numbers, helping keep the project status aligned with actual production progress.

SurvOPT can also check Havian for vessel position data: Vessel data is used to update the vessel time and location within the SurvOPT project, and also store historical vessel positions in VesselTRACK format.

This integration streamlines workflows and improves data consistency between SurvOPT and Havian.

Improved AI Help

The AI Help feature has been improved to provide more accurate and helpful responses to user queries. The AI Help system now has access to a wider range of information about SurvOPT’s features and functionality, as well as extra knowledgebase articles, allowing it to assist users more effectively.

Chat with AI Help at any time from Help menu > AI powered help. If you ask questions in a language other than English, AI Help will respond in the same language.

NORSAR exports now factor feather into streamer modelling

When exporting to NORSAR, the calculated source and streamer positions now factor in feather. This results in more accurate shot and receiver locations in the NORSAR project, particularly when the survey area is affected by large tide or current variations.

Note: The more intensive calculations may increase export time for large projects. To get a faster estimate, consider decimating the exported positions, by setting “Export every X shot” to a higher value when configuring the export.

Bug fixes and usability improvements

  • Usability: More reliable handling of WMS (web map service) requests. SurvOPT now defaults to using WMS schema version 1.3.0 when parsing WMS responses (new installs only), and will try WMS schema versions from 1.0.0 through to 1.3.0 if the default fails.
  • Fixed: AI Help escalation requests failed to send in some cases.
